  • Introducing Same Same but Tech, a podcast where the smartest people in the universe explain tech buzzwords, one analogy at a time. Featuring guests from Google Cloud, Microsoft HoloLens, Twitch, Gemini, CAA, Tor, Verizon, YouTube, x.ai, Paramount Pictures, ConsenSys, GIPHY, and more. Every week, we join host Mauhan M Zonoozy, a seasoned startup founder and angel investor, as he asks the brightest minds in tech to de-jargon the industry’s biggest buzzwords. The twist? We have our guests explain the technology using analogies. Sort of like a dictionary for tech, but quirkier and with a better soundtrack.
